While the Marrowgate building is under renovation, all staff and visitors report to the temporary site at Quill Street. New starters should note that visitors must be met in the ground-floor lobby and escorted at all times; unaccompanied visitors will be turned back by the duty concierge. Escorts sign guests in and out personally. To reach the upper floors, use the lift keypad with the code shown below.

turnstile pass: bdg-QZV-3

Health checks: the Farrowline balancer probes each app node at /healthz every 10 seconds. Two consecutive failures pull the node from rotation; three successes restore it. Do not add dependencies to the health endpoint — it must stay shallow. Deep checks live at /readyz and are polled by the Copperjay monitor instead. Copperjay requires authentication for registering new probe targets. Use the key below when configuring your node.

API key for yahig-tadup: kto7_ubizbYm

## Limits and Quotas — PaperLoom Spooler

The PaperLoom spooler enforces hard caps on queue depth, job size, and per-tenant concurrency to protect downstream render nodes at the Kestrel Hollow facility. Exceeding any quota returns a retryable rejection rather than silently dropping jobs. Before each release, verify the shipped defaults against the values below, which are the approved production tuning constants.

constants for tafog-kahag:
RATE_LIMITS = {
    "sorir": 697,
    "oliox": 683,
    "holax": 176,
    "casox": 60,
    "pelius": 382,
}

## Runbook: Hushwire alert deduplicator

Plugin authors: Hushwire dedupes by fingerprint, and your plugin's grouping keys feed straight into that hash. If you emit unstable keys (timestamps, UUIDs), every alert looks unique and pagers melt. Keep keys deterministic, and test against the replay harness before publishing. Dedup windows are 10 minutes by default. Your plugin manifest must pin the harness build listed below.

session token of tajef-bageg = htk21_5d90d574934f3ccae6437